4 Injured As 2 Groups Clash In Odisha’s Bhadrak, Prohibitory Orders Clamped

Bhadrak: At least four people were injured, one of them critically, after two groups entered into a violent clash in Dhusuri area of Odisha’s Bhadrak district on Thursday.

As per sources, the clash took place at Godipokhari Bazaar under the jurisdiction of Dhusuri police station.

The clash reportedly took place following heated arguments after members of a group allegedly tore the flag of another a group belonging to a community.

Four persons were injured in the incident. They were rushed to a hospital for treatment. One of them who was critically injured was shifted to SCB Medical College and Hospital in Cuttack.

Police personnel in strength have been deployed in the area following the violent incident, while prohibitory orders under section 163 of BNSS were clamped in the village and surrounding areas as a precautionary measure to prevent any further flare up.

The prohibitory orders will remain in force till 10 pm of September 21, official sources said.

The local police have been directed to make announcement about the promulgation of section 163 through loud speaker in the area and take necessary action to disperse any gathering. Local authorities have been directed to take necessary steps to maintain law and order and disperse any mobs that may gather.

Police have taken three persons into custody for their alleged involvement in the violence, the sources said.
